
The Maryland Master Gardener Program is proud to announce our revised 2012 Master Gardener Handbook.

Price: $69.00
We are currently taking orders for the newly revised 2012 Master Gardener Handbook.
- Brand new Ecology chapter, a revised Turf chapter and a much more detailed index
- 28 chapters, 669 pages including over 400 color photos.
- Stated learning objectives for each chapter
- 5 chapters on the basics: ecology, botany, soils, entomology, plant diseases
- 8 chapters on plant groups: turfgrass, herbaceous plants, woody plants, vegetables, small fruits, tree fruits, herbs, and houseplants
- 15 chapters on other important topics (e.g. composting, landscape design, aquatic gardening, wetlands, wildlife, weeds, invasive species, alternatives to turf, landscape design, water quality and conservation)
- A 114 page integrated pest management section that includes diagnosic keys for all major plant groups and special keys for cultural and environmental problems and structural and nuisance pests.
- Extensive glossary, index, and resource appendix
- Durable spiral binding and laminated covers
- A Bay-Wise approach to gardening that will help you improve your soil, nurture your plants, and manage most pests without pesticides.
